Album Description

First domestic collection that compiles material from their first nine albums, including 'Journey To The Center Of The Eye', 'A Tab In The Ocean', 'Recycled', 'Sounds Like This', and others. 21 tracks in all. Comes packaged in a double slimline jewel case within a full color slipase sleeve. 1998 Purple Pyramid/ Cleopatra release. The full title is 'Dream Nebula: The Best Of 1971-1975'.

3 out of 5 stars "Remember" where you left the master tapes!.......1999-08-13

I was ready to give this release a glowing review until I listened to the song, "Remember the Future"... That was when I realized they still are using the wrong master tape for this classic tune! When will the people in charge at Bellaphon pull their heads out of their @## and find the correct version of this song for release? I'm tired of wasting my money on their poor quality CDs.
